Onboarding note for PortionWise, our recipe-scaling calculator. New folks: the scaling engine lives in the `ratiocore` repo, and unit conversions are table-driven. The staging database snapshot is encrypted, so you'll need to unlock it before running integration tests. Ask in the sync if anything fails. The passphrase to unlock the staging snapshot is the following:

unlock words, fahog-yahof: belael-holael-eliius-joreth-tamax-olimir-norwyn-holwyn-fraath-lamius-norwyn-druys-soriel

Runbook fragment — Papergrain invoice renderer. If PDF generation queues back up, check the font-cache volume first; a full cache causes silent render retries. Restart the worker pool only after draining in-flight jobs, or invoices duplicate. Escalate to the Billing Crew if backlog exceeds one hour. The drain procedure and escalation rota are documented on the page below.

wiki page, fajof-tajef: https://vault.tolvaqio.corp/board/pipeline/pages/ticket/c20d7f984bcc9e12

Ticket: Config drift in Plumage template renderer

Rendering latency on prod-east is 3x staging. Root cause: prod-east never picked up the cache-warming settings from the Plumage v4 rollout. Someone hand-edited the node config in March and it was never reconciled. New folks: always change config through Hearthfile, never on the box. Fix is to reapply the canonical values and restart the renderer pool. Canonical values below.

deployment values, kajep-kageg:
[praix]
host = praix.paliqcorp.corp
user = praix_svc
database = praix_prod